Wegovy weight-loss pill approved in UK

Wegovy, a medication developed by Novo Nordisk, has been approved for use in the UK, marking a notable development in the field of obesity treatment. This approval could potentially provide a more convenient option for individuals seeking to manage their weight.
Key Facts
- The Wegovy weight-loss pill has been approved for use in the UK, according to the manufacturer Novo Nordisk, which suggests that a daily tablet of the drug could be more convenient for some people than weekly injections.
